Okay, I ran the HWmonitor and noticed that my temperature for my CPU was 87 degrees Celsius when it crashed. When I rebooted my computer I also got a message from the bios saying that the cpu is overheating. I never get that message when the computer normally crashes without me running the HWmonitor but I don't think that really matters. So it may be a cooling problem?

Okay so the way I actually solved this was cleaning out the PC with compressed air. There was a lot of dust in there. Just goes to show that the easiest problems should be tested first. I want to thank alexoiu for trying to help me. I appreciate man. Merry Christmas.
